Ordinals
beta
Sat 1387386086985504
decimal
344954.1086985504
degree
0°134954′218″1086985504‴
percentile
66.0660042148395%
name
eafkxqabgnh
cycle
0
epoch
1
period
171
block
344954
offset
1086985504
timestamp
2015-02-24 14:07:19 UTC
rarity
common
prev
next